specRolloff~

The specRolloff~ object calculates the spectral rolloff frequency of an audio signal, representing the frequency below which a specified percentage of the total spectral energy is concentrated. It serves as an audio descriptor, useful for real-time timbre identification. Users can customize parameters such as window size, energy concentration target, windowing function, and whether to use a power spectrum.

    Open Pd and go to ToolsFind Externals. Search for timbreIDLib and install it. Then create an object with declare -lib timbreIDLib -path timbreIDLib. Finally, use specRolloff~ or any other object from timbreIDLib.
